What Exactly Is an Emergency Electrician?

An emergency electrician isn’t just an electrician working late. They are specially equipped and on-call to handle urgent electrical problems that pose immediate danger to your home, property, or family. Think of them as the first responders for your electrical system. While a regular electrician handles planned upgrades and repairs during business hours, emergency electricians are the ones you call when your lights go out at midnight, you smell burning from an outlet, or your circuit breaker won’t stop tripping. Their priority is your safety, which means they’re available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, including holidays.

What Qualifies as a True Electrical Emergency?

Not every flickering light needs a midnight call. A true electrical emergency is any situation where delaying repair could lead to fire, electrocution, or significant property damage. Here are clear signs that you’re facing an emergency:

  • Smoke, Burning Smells, or Sparks: Coming from outlets, switches, or your electrical panel.
  • No Power at All: When your entire house is dark and neighboring homes have power, indicating a problem with your service.
  • Buzzing or Humming Sounds: From your breaker panel or outlets.
  • Exposed, Damaged, or Frayed Wiring: Often found during renovations or after a storm.
  • Water and Electricity Mixing: An outlet or appliance that’s gotten wet.
  • Frequent Circuit Breaker Trips: That won’t reset, signaling a dangerous overload or short.

Why Warm Springs Homes Face Unique Electrical Risks

Our local climate and housing directly impact electrical safety. Summer thunderstorms rolling in from the mountains can bring lightning surges that overwhelm older surge protectors and damage outdoor service lines. In winter, the bitter cold puts extra strain on heating systems and can cause wiring in uninsulated crawlspaces or attics to become brittle.

Homes built before the 1980s in older parts of town, like near the historic Main Street area or in the quiet neighborhoods off Canyon Road, often still have smaller, 60- or 100-amp electrical panels. These were designed for fewer appliances and can easily overload with today’s demands, leading to overheated wires. Some may even contain outdated aluminum wiring, which requires special connections to be safe.

Furthermore, our rural setting means response times from the main utility can vary. If a tree limb takes down a service line on your property during a storm, you’ll need an emergency electrician to make the repair safely before the utility can restore service. Understanding Emergency Electrician Costs in Warm Springs

Emergency services cost more than a scheduled appointment, and it’s important to know why. You’re paying for immediate response, specialized after-hours availability, and priority service that puts your safety first. Here’s a transparent breakdown of what goes into the cost:

  • Emergency Call-Out/Dispatch Fee: This is a flat fee to cover immediate mobilization. In the Warm Springs area, this typically ranges from $125 to $250. This fee is applied regardless of the job’s complexity.
  • After-Hours/Labor Premium: Work performed outside standard business hours (evenings, weekends, holidays) usually incurs a higher hourly rate. This can be 1.5 to 2 times the standard rate. Standard electrician labor rates in Montana average $80-$120 per hour.
  • Diagnostics: Time spent identifying the root cause of the problem.
  • Parts & Materials: The cost of any breakers, wiring, outlets, or other components needed.
  • Travel/Distance Fee: For remote properties outside of Warm Springs proper, a travel fee may apply.
  • Permits & Inspection Fees: For significant repairs like panel upgrades or new circuit runs, the electrician will pull the required local permits, and these costs are passed through.

Cost Scenario Examples:

Scenario 1: Nighttime Breaker Panel Issue. Your main breaker keeps tripping on a Saturday night. The emergency electrician arrives, diagnoses a faulty main breaker, and replaces it. Cost might include: $175 call-out fee + 2 hours of after-hours labor at $180/hour + $150 for the new breaker. Estimated Total: $685.

Scenario 2: Storm-Damaged Outdoor Outlet. A summer storm causes water intrusion and sparking in an exterior outlet. The electrician isolates the circuit, replaces the weatherproof outlet and cover, and ensures the GFCI protection is working. Cost might include: $125 call-out fee + 1.5 hours of labor at the standard $100/hour + $40 in parts. Estimated Total: $270.

What to Do Until Help Arrives: A Safety Checklist

Your actions before we get there are critical:

  1. If Safe to Do So: Turn off the main breaker in your electrical panel to cut all power.
  2. If You See Downed Power Lines: Stay far away (at least 30 feet) and call your utility company immediately.
  3. Evacuate: If you smell strong burning or see smoke, get everyone out of the house.
  4. Unplug Appliances: On the affected circuit to prevent further overload.
  5. Do NOT Use Water: On an electrical fire. Use a Class C fire extinguisher.
  6. Document: Take photos of any visible damage for insurance purposes.

Local Regulations and Safety in Warm Springs

In Montana, electrical work typically requires a permit and follow-up inspection for any new circuit runs, panel upgrades, or service changes. A reputable emergency electrician will handle this for you. For problems involving the service mast (where power enters your home) or the utility-owned lines up to the pole, we will coordinate directly with the utility company to ensure a safe and code-compliant resolution.
